Can lithium batteries be integrated with wind energy systems?
As the world increasingly embraces renewable energy solutions, the integration of lithium battery storage with wind energy systems emerges as a pivotal innovation. Lithium batteries, with their remarkable effectiveness, durability, and high energy density, are perfectly poised to address one of the key challenges of wind power: its variability.
Are lithium battery storage systems safe in wind energy projects?
Ensuring the safety of lithium battery storage systems in wind energy projects is paramount. Given the high energy density of lithium batteries, proper safety measures are essential to mitigate risks such as thermal runaway, short circuits, and chemical leaks.

Could Norway become the 'green battery of Europe'?
Wind energy in Norway currently accounts for 10% of the production capacity and is now dominating investments. Although the country doesn’t actually need offshore wind farms to produce electricity, it is developing today more renewable energy production capacity than it has for decades and could become the ‘green battery of Europe’.
